Faja dos Cubres seasonal overview
Faja dos Cubres in Portugal is a spot that receives consistent ground swell, particularly from autumn through early spring, making it a reliable destination for intermediate to advanced surfers. The best months for quality waves are from October to March, with December standing out due to the highest mean swell size (2.3m) and a good balance of ground swell dominance (79%) and workable wind conditions (52% favorable). November and February also offer solid conditions, with strong ground swell presence (78-85%) and decent swell heights (2.0-2.1m). January is similarly consistent, though wind conditions are less favorable (44% good winds). March and April see a slight drop in ground swell influence but still provide surfable waves. The summer months (May to September) bring smaller, wind-driven swells and weaker conditions, with July being the least ideal—low swell size (0.9m) and mostly wind swell dominance (84%). However, late spring (May) and early autumn (September) can offer occasional good sessions if wind conditions align. Overall, the prime window for powerful, clean waves is winter, particularly December, while summer is better suited for beginners or those seeking mellower conditions. Wind consistency is best in October (54% good winds), but surfers should expect more onshore winds during peak swell season.

Conditions at Faja dos Cubres in April
April at Faja dos Cubres offers consistent surf conditions with an average swell height of 1.9m and a solid period of 11.2s, ensuring well-organized and powerful waves. The dominant swell direction comes from the NW to NNW sector, contributing to the majority of waves in the 1-2.5m range—ideal for intermediate to advanced surfers. Around 40% of the time, wind conditions are favorable, typically light to moderate (below 20kph) from the north to northeast, providing clean or slightly textured faces. However, stronger onshore winds from the west and southwest occasionally disrupt conditions, though they are less frequent. The spot handles larger swells well, especially in the 1.5-2.5m range, where NW swells deliver the best quality. Expect a mix of playful mid-sized days and occasional heavier sessions, with a decent chance of scoring clean, powerful waves when the winds cooperate. Overall, April is a reliable month for surfers comfortable with head-high+ waves and variable wind challenges.
